Overview Gastractiv 1mg/ml Drop
PediaGastric 1mg/ml oral drops effectively manage indigestion, gastroesophageal reflux, nausea, and vomiting in pediatric patients. It accelerates gastric emptying and intestinal transit, alleviating bloating, satiety, and stomach upset. Administer PediaGastric 30 minutes prior to meals for optimal absorption; post-meal administration remains effective but may reduce bioavailability. Infants may receive a doctor-prescribed four times daily dosage, spaced at least four hours apart, ideally before each feeding. Dosage is individualized based on the child's age, weight, and condition. Never extend treatment beyond the prescribed duration without consulting a physician. If vomiting occurs within 30 minutes, repeat the dose after the child has settled; however, avoid doubling the dose if it's near the next scheduled time. Minor, transient side effects like dry mouth, headache, lethargy, abdominal cramping, and diarrhea may occur, usually resolving with continued use. Persistent or concerning side effects warrant immediate medical attention. Inform your child's doctor of any prior allergies, cardiac conditions, hematological disorders, congenital anomalies, respiratory issues, lung abnormalities, gastrointestinal problems, dermatological conditions, hepatic impairment, or renal dysfunction. A comprehensive medical history ensures accurate dosage adjustments and optimal treatment planning.

How Gastractiv 1mg/ml Drop works:
Reglan 1mg/ml oral drops stimulate gastrointestinal motility. Their mechanism involves central action on the brain's emetic center and peripheral effects enhancing stomach and intestinal contractions, facilitating efficient gastric emptying.
SAFETY ADVICE
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with severe kidney impairment should use Gastractiv 1mg/ml oral drops cautiously. Dosage modification of Gastractiv 1mg/ml oral drops might be necessary. Physician consultation is advised. Especially during extended treatment, regular assessment of kidney function is recommended.
LiverCAUTION
For individuals with liver impairment, Gastractiv 1mg/ml drops require careful administration, potentially necessitating dose modification. Physician consultation is advised. The use of Gastractiv 1mg/ml drops is contraindicated in children exhibiting severe hepatic dysfunction. Pediatric administration should only occur under a physician's guidance.
